Glitterlimes – Meet the 2012 BBB Vendors!

Hello, friends of the BBB!

Today we get to learn a little bit about Debbie of Glitterlimes, maker of super cool and unique jewelry made from real (yes, real!) fruit and candy!

Hi there! First things first: What’s your name, what’s your business name, where are you from, and where are you currently located/crafting?

Debbie Tuch, Glitterlimes, I am from Philadelphia and San Francisco, I currently residing in Brooklyn.

How did you get your start? Please tell us a little bit about how your business went from an idea to what is is today.

I was making faux opals at RISD and there was a boom and a bang and it got all over my lime! When I moved to SF after school, I would frequent the markets, the farms, the international food stores, and find amazing produce and candies from around the world. I was hooked and have been for 16 years.

What inspires you the most to create?
Amazing design in nature and in iconic foods we all love and eat.

What are your favorite materials to work with?

Food, glitter, and resin.
